The Grain Size Application Package for Clemex Vision leverages machine learning capabilities, including a special instruction for martensitic grains. The new automatic algorithm provides a fast, reliable, and accurate way of optically identifying challenging martensitic microstructures.

Martensitic microstructures are difficult to analyze optically because of the materials’ resistance to etching techniques. Grain structures are barely visible and typically a lab will rely on the human eye to distinguish and classify them.

The gray thresholding technique used in image analysis software is not appropriate for this kind of image, as it is based on the gray level distribution of pixels. It works well with clearly defined phases that form distinct peaks on the thresholding graph.

Clemex Vision PE now has a way of processing images of various martensitic structures which does not depend on gray level thresholding. This breakthrough was accomplished after months of work on hundreds of images from industry partners.
